The Role:
  • REQUIRED: Python programming skills
  • Solid SQL skills
  • Familiarity with Unix systems, shell scripting, and Git
  • Experience with relational (SQL), non-relational (NoSQL), and/or object data stores (e.g., Snowflake, MongoDB, S3, HDFS, Postgres, Redis, DynamoDB)
  • Interest in building and experimenting with different tools and tech, and sharing your learnings with the broader organization
  • The desire to work with other teams in the organization (e.g., Development, Business Intelligence, Data Science) to build tools and solutions that support and help manage data within the Fetch ecosystem
  • Bachelor’s degree in Computer Science (or equivalent)
  • At least 3 years of relevant full-time work experience
Bonus points for:
  • Excellent written and verbal communication skills
  • Familiarity with open source software and dependency management
  • ETL process, data pipeline, and/or micro-service development experience
  • Cloud engineering and DevOps skills (e.g., AWS, CloudFormation, Docker)
  • Familiarity with messaging and asynchronous technologies (e.g., SQS, Kinesis, RabbitMQ, Kafka)
  • Big data development skills (e.g., Spark, Hadoop, MPP DW)
  • Experience with visualization tools (e.g., Tableau)
